About the Role The Therapeutic Franchise Head (TFH) will serve as an operational expert in the relevant area of therapeutic expertise and is responsible for the development of strategies to support new business proposals for Emerald Clinical and the holistic sale to delivery of contracted work in clinical trials within their therapeutic area of expertise. Key accountabilities Operational strategy Accountable for the creation and optimization of innovative and compelling delivery strategies and solutions for Early and Late Phase, multi-service, multi-region studies or programs, that leverage EC's expertise in the relevant therapeutic area as well as operational capabilities: Work with relevant experts to differentiate Emerald Clinical from its competitors in assigned area Actively support long-term business growth through collaboration with Emerald Clinical Functional Area Heads and other stakeholders Actively support long-term business growth through collaboration with external Centres of Excellence and other external stakeholders including current and potential partners Responsible for creating effective delivery strategies and solutions for all projects in assigned area of operational expertise including addressing the specific needs and challenges of each project and customer Responsible for engaging and coordinating Operations Area Lead team members to align with the global operational strategy in the specified therapeutic area. Develop relevant training materials and a library of resources (as needed) to support project leads, both regionally and globally, in their project deliverables New business In partnership with Emerald Clinical Business Development, Medical Services, Proposals, Operations, and other functions, responsible for award of business to achieve identified new business targets in the relevant therapeutic area: Collaborate with Business Development to evaluate and manage new opportunities from receipt through pricing and proposal development, and to award decision. This may include, but is not limited to, standalone programs and projects, requests for information (RFI), capabilities, early engagement, and partnering discussions Actively support Business Development in the preparation for and conduct of customer facing meetings. This includes and is not limited to; training and preparation of the assigned project team; provision of specific content; ensuring all content effectively conveys project strategy and critical win themes. Develop and review project budgets (service fees and pass-through costs) aligned with the requested project strategy, and with the contribution margin targets and pricing strategy agreed with Sales, EC leadership, and other stakeholders Attend and present at customer meetings including bid defence and partnership meetings, as required Coordinate with Business Development to complete follow-up actions identified at bid defences and other customer/ partnership meetings Project delivery and governance Act as Emerald Clinical project champion for awarded projects within the relevant therapeutic area. Through this role, work with Operations Project Delivery Leaders to enable the assigned project delivery team to understand and implement the project strategy that was sold, and to evaluate and recommend effective adjustments to strategy when any trends or triggers associated with progress indicate this is required: Guide and mentor assigned Project Leads through comprehensive handover of awarded project. Facilitate the Project Leaders understanding of all aspects of the awarded project so they can confidently present the project strategy to the client and the internal stakeholders. Define and communicate the project team profile and organizational structure that will enable operational managers to identify and assign team members that can meet the customer’s needs and successfully secure the project award Continue to guide and mentor project leads throughout the project lifecycle including adjustments to delivery strategy when project or program progress, trends, and milestones indicate intervention required Function as an escalation point and governance contact for awarded projects within the therapeutic area About You Tertiary qualifications in a related science or health care discipline Minimum of 10 years global clinical research experience, including proven track record in hands on operational project delivery and/or drug development experience Minimum of 5 years global business development experience, ideally in a hands-on capacity but otherwise to show direct involvement in associated processes e.g. RFP, BDMs, client leadership and relationship management Expert experience in one or more operational areas and ability to understand and implement projects within assigned area of expertise Up to date knowledge and access to information that supports effectiveness as a Operational Strategy lead including understanding Emerald Clinical’s services, and product offerings, status and trends in assigned area(s), innovations and advances in clinical trial methodology, and business intelligence. Demonstrated ability to understand customer needs, have difficult conversations with internal/external stakeholders and customers, negotiate solutions and understand impacts on the overall offering. Excellent communication, presentation and interpersonal skills, including good command of English language (both written and spoken). Strong leadership skills, ability to work with minimal supervision, and lead a virtual team in a matrix organization. Strong business acumen including confidence with financial considerations, excellent negotiation and influencing skills, and comfortable working in both sales and operational environments.
